CAS 790-45-4
:Peroxide, benzoyl 4-chlorobenzoyl
Description:
Benzoyl 4-chlorobenzoyl peroxide, with the CAS number 790-45-4, is an organic peroxide commonly used as a radical initiator in polymerization processes and as a bleaching agent in various applications. This compound features a peroxide functional group, which is characterized by the presence of a -O-O- bond, making it a source of free radicals upon thermal decomposition. It is typically a white to off-white crystalline solid that is sensitive to heat and light, necessitating careful handling and storage in a cool, dark environment. The presence of the benzoyl and 4-chlorobenzoyl groups contributes to its reactivity and solubility properties, allowing it to dissolve in organic solvents. Benzoyl 4-chlorobenzoyl peroxide is also utilized in the cosmetic industry, particularly in acne treatment formulations, due to its antibacterial properties. However, it can be a skin irritant, and appropriate safety measures should be taken when handling this compound. Overall, its unique chemical structure and properties make it valuable in both industrial and cosmetic applications.
Formula:C14H9ClO4
